senseless is a combination of 3 games designed to test your senses.

VISUAL
- Numbers will be flashed a a few seconds in a random order, and it's your duty to remember where they stand, and have them in proper order.

AUDIBLE
- Simon just got a whole new revamped look. You will be shown a particular pattern and you will have to repeat the pattern by recognizing the tones and visual cues.

THOUGHT
-Your brain is messing with you. Try matching the colors that are displayed on a series of descriptive text that describes another color. Now thats tricky!

Game comes with artistic drawings and mastered soundtracks! An experience not to be missed.

QUOTE(david888 @ Apr 12 2009, 02:35 PM)
hi,

just to check with malaysia iphone developers, how does Apple make the payments to developers, by cheque or by direct wire transfer into our malaysia bank account?
*
They will actually bank it directly into your account. You will need to setup your bank account on itunesconnect. I have setup my MAYBANK account and they direct debit into my account. Thats the reason they wait for the earnings to reach USD $250 since they do not want to spend money for bank transfers for lower amounts of payouts. It will not make sense for Apple.

QUOTE(xandman @ Jul 3 2009, 08:33 AM)
hey man.
i never knew the setting bank account part...
thanks for the enlightenment! rclxms.gif


Added on July 3, 2009, 8:33 ambtw how do we do it?
*
All you need is your bank account, address and SWIFT number (which you can get from your bank). Then you will have to enter the details in itunesconnect. Thats all.

For the tax form, you will just have to enter "000000000" in the EIN coloumn.

QUOTE(gengstapo @ Jul 4 2009, 09:33 AM)
Similar question here, so what if we produce a FREE app?
Do Apple pay us for it or how?
*
Hi guys here are my responses:

- itunesconnect can be accessed at itunesconnect.apple.com
- the $99 is for a yearly contract. Need to renew it every year
- you don't get paid for free apps. It's more for marketing your paid apps
